The project is implemented at OJSC "Arkhangelsk PPM" in Novodvinsk, Russian Federation.
The project suggests utilization of bark and wood wastes (BWW) and waste water sludge from biological waste water treatment (WWS) that are generated mainly in the process of pulp production at APPM. The wastes are to be utilized in APPM-owned TPP-3 for steam and power generation to cover the auxiliary needs of the Mill. The project makes it possible to additionally utilize up to 150 k tonnes of bark with 60% moisture content and up to 110 k tonnes of waste water sludge with 70% moisture content which otherwise would be disposed at a dump, and to additionally generate around 350 k Gcal of steam per year from biomass and to reduce fossil fuel (coal and heavy fuel oil) consumption at APPM by 80 k tonnes of equivalent fuel per year.
GHG emission reductions under the projects are achieved due to increase in the share of effectively combusted BWW and WWS in the fuel and energy balance of APPM with corresponding reduction of the share of fossil fuels, and also due to reduction in BWW and WWS disposal at dumps.
Expected emission reductions over 2008-2012 – 1 021 kt ÑÎ2e
